Output ebd77ba7fddd5d6811a6722058234205a28506cff4705b475126632554b56974:2

value
104000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9786a37072536aff3ed3e2bc9ae96988987aa1cb OP_EQUALVERIFY OP_CHECKSIG
address
1EpCKouttwi39Ng6N6kuiDmxZUT8xV33XQ
transaction
ebd77ba7fddd5d6811a6722058234205a28506cff4705b475126632554b56974
spent
true